During the obscure times of the middle ages an enlightened man walked along the ridges and valleys of the Apennines, looking for God's signs in nature and talking to people about peace, humility and brotherhood. He was Francis of Assisi a mystical personage who fascinates, even now, people from all countries; his charisma and philosophy are recognized, also, by all religions of the World.
Thanks to this trip you can follow the routes which Saint Francis covered during his frequent pilgrimages between the area of La Verna (where he received the stigmata), and the area of Assisi (where he was born and died); you can discover hidden evidences of his passage, such as Franciscan hermitages, chapels, crosses, walking inside forests and the typical countryside landscape of Tuscany and Umbria.
Apart from amazing places for religion and nature, along the Franciscan Path is possible to get in touch with history and culture, as well as taste the traditional recipes from the local poor cuisine.
Arrive in Chiusi della Verna, a quiet hamlet at the base of La Verna Mountain. After checking in to your hotel, walk along the medieval path to the Franciscan Sanctuary of La Verna and the ancient forest around; discover the many secrets of the Sanctuary and the signs of Saint Francis.
Villages along the way: Chiusi della Verna
Walk along the edge of the Catenaia Alps between the Arno and Tiber valleys. Rest at Casella Hermitage, built in the point where Saint Francis last time looked at his holy mountain coming back to Assisi. Enjoy the several panoramic points over Casentino and Valtiberina and watch the other mountain chain around with the most important picks.
Challenge: 10 km, 880m ascending, 600m descending, 5 hours
Villages along the way: Caprese Michelangelo
Enjoy to day's walk through the woods of Catenaia Alps to the amazing town of Anghiari. Descend from the top of the mountain, along a wild trail and observe the change of typical vegetation (beech and chestnut trees to oaks). Cross the Monti Rognosi, impressive hills composed by magmatic rocks. Discover interesting places according to local tradition and superstition. Admire the vast Montedoglio Lake and the Valley of Tiber River.
Challenge: 16 km, 200m ascending, 1400m descending, 6.0 hours
Villages along the way: Anghiari
Walk in the countryside around Anghiari along panoramic gravel roads. Discover medieval churches as the Pieve di Sovara. A short extension allows getting the amazing Galbino Castle, built in the 16th century. After the walk you will be transferred to San Sepolcro; according to the legend this town was founded by two pilgrims returning from the Holy Land with a fragment of Christ's tomb and they chose the place as a shrine for this relict. The name Sansepolcro comes from Santo Sepolcro which means "holy sepulchre". We recommend to walk inside this noble town and taste typical products.
Challenge: 15 km, 340m ascending, 795m descending, 5.0 hours
Following the Tiber River, the itinerary crosses one of most cultivated valleys in Italy, the Valtiberina. The local important and famous product is tobacco which is used for the production of Tuscan cigars. The to day's walk is completely flat and runs along country roads or parallel paths to the river; fields and pastures alternate with preserved bank vegetation composed by poplars and willows. In this kinds of environments it is easy to see many birds of prey or water birds as Kestrel, Montagu's Harrier, Grey Heron, Little Egret, Night-Heron, Moorhen etc..
Challenge: 19 km, 0m ascending, 0m descending, 6 hours
Villages along the way: San Sepolcro
You get the hamlet of Valfabbrica by taxi and start to follow the Strada Francescana della Pace; this itinerary runs along the typical hills of Umbria, rich in clay and sand soil. The walk is quite demanding whit some hard slopes which get impressive panoramic point; you can avoid one harder section follow instructions. In the last part you sight Assisi from a top of hills; the walk passes directly from the countryside to the centre of the town. It is strictly recommend walking in the town enjoying its history, art and structure.
Challenge: 12 km, 615m ascending, 956m descending, 5 hours
Villages along the way: Assisi
Both the itineraries to day, take you across the Subasio Mountain from the north side to the south side, leaving from the Eremo delle Carceri to Spello. You will enjoy wonderful landscapes along the routes covered by Saint Francis during his pilgrimages; it is a trip inside wilderness and spirituality, discovering pleasant hermitages and hamlets.
Challenge: Itinerary 1: 8 km, 473m ascendnig, 940m descending, 3 hours
Itinerary 2: 14 km, 524m ascending, 1015m descending, 5 hours
Villages along the way: Eremo delle Carceri and Spello
